Required Skills

Required skills

Required skills include

undertaking selfdirected problem solving and decisionmaking on issues of a broad andor highly specialised nature and in highly varied andor highly specialised contexts

communicating at all levels in the organisation and value stream and to audiences of different levels of literacy and numeracy

analysing current statesituation of the organisation and value stream

determining and implementing the most appropriate method for capturing value stream improvements

collecting and interpreting data and qualitative information from a variety of sources

analysing individually and collectively the implementation of competitive systems and practices tools in the organisation and determining strategies for improved implementation

relating implementation and use of competitive systems and practices and continuous improvement to customer benefit

solving highly varied and highly specialised problems related to competitive systems and practices implementation and continuous improvement to root cause

negotiating with stakeholders where required to obtain information required for implementation and refinement of continuous improvements including management unions value stream members employees and members of the community

reviewing relevant metrics including all those measures which might be used to determine the performance of the improvement system including

key performance indicators KPIs for existing processes

quality statistics

delivery timing and quantity statistics

processequipment reliability uptime

incident and nonconformance reports

implementing continuous improvement to support systems and areas including maintenance office training and human resources

Required knowledge

Required knowledge includes

competitivesystems and practicestools including

value stream mapping

S

Just in Time JIT

mistake proofing

process mapping

establishing customer pull

kaizen and kaizen blitz

setting of KPIsmetrics

identification and elimination of waste muda

continuous improvement processes including implementation monitoring and evaluation strategies for a whole organisation and its value stream

difference between breakthrough improvement and continuous improvement

organisational goals processes and structure

approval processes within organisation

costbenefit analysis methods

methods of determining the impact of a change

advantages and disadvantages of communication media methods and formats for different messages and audiences

customer perception of value

define measure analyse improve and control and sustain DMAIC process

Competitive systems and practices

Competitive systems and practices may include, but are not limited to:

lean operations

agile operations

preventative and predictive maintenance approaches

monitoring and data gathering systems, such as Systems Control and Data Acquisition (SCADA) software, Enterprise Resource Planning (ERP) systems, Materials Resource Planning (MRP) and proprietary systems

statistical process control systems, including six sigma and three sigma

JIT, kanban and other pull-related operations control systems

supply, value, and demand chain monitoring and analysis

5S

continuous improvement (kaizen)

breakthrough improvement (kaizen blitz)

cause/effect diagrams

overall equipment effectiveness (OEE)

takt time

process mapping

problem solving

run charts

standard procedures

current reality tree

Competitive systems and practices should be interpreted so as to take into account:

the stage of implementation of competitive systems and practices

the size of the enterprise

the work organisation, culture, regulatory environment and the industry sector

Improvement process yield

Improvement process yield may be regarded as:

the benefit achieved for the effort invested

Breakthrough improvements

Breakthrough improvements include:

those which result from a kaizen blitz or other improvement project or event and are a subset of all improvements

Timing of breakthrough improvements

Timing of breakthrough improvements includes:

frequency (which should be maximised) and duration (which should be minimised) of events/projects

Continuous improvement

Continuous improvement is part of normal work and does not require a special event to occur (although may still require authorisations) and contrasts with breakthrough improvement/kaizen blitz which occurs by way of an event or project
